Output 1853bcf42fbabc29cd07de3dcb4e54b6b811936f302cdacbb9cf203752aac9d0:1

value
150003670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131423781774813433894b1fd39584af7ed1ea53 OP_EQUAL
address
33RttST4sDzHF4GGruY2exd3MpSGQ2JwjV
transaction
1853bcf42fbabc29cd07de3dcb4e54b6b811936f302cdacbb9cf203752aac9d0
confirmations
473379
spent
true